From the Rolls-Royce experimental archive: a quarter of a million communications from Rolls-Royce, 1906 to 1960's. Documents from the Sir Henry Royce Memorial Foundation (SHRMF).
Letter from S. Smith & Sons confirming instructions to hand-paint a red danger mark on a special Bentley Revolution Counter Clock.

Identifier  ExFiles\Box 164\1\  img105
Date  4th July 1933

July 4th, 1933.
Messrs. Rolls-Royce, Limited,
DERBY.
For the attention of Mr. West
WST
Dear Sirs,
Confirming our conversation this afternoon in regard to the special Bentley Revolution Counter Clock our subsidiary Company - Messrs. Jaeger - are making up for you, we have instructed them, upon your advice, to hand-paint on the dial a red segment danger mark between 4500 and 5000.
Yours faithfully,
for S.SMITH & SONS (MOTOR ACCESSORIES)LD.
MANAGER CONTRACTS DEPARTMENT
